Yes, Mew was nearly as relaxed as one Kelvin Moore, I swear he had control of the space time continuum, he had so much time to stroll from FB.
 
Peter Knights was an A-grade superstar of the competition. Would have won a brownlow except for a late season injury. The Robert Redford of the AFL.... minus the ginger.

Mew.... did not reach the heights of Knights as an individual.... but they would be equals within the club and among supporters. Mew taking marks with his head down... classic. I remember singing in the terraces "We got Chris Mew, number 2. We got Chris Mew, number 2. We got Chris Mew, number 2.... we got the best team in the world".

They both fit in the GOAT team as Knights can play forward.

Sicily has a long way to go to compare with those two giants (arguably not a fair comparison atm for Sic).

Chris Langford would have played 100+ games at CHB. Always played on Carey, Kernas, etc. would usually take the biggest forward whether they were FF or CHF.
Sicily doesn’t play on the CHF so I would not call him a CHB. He is a floating backman.

Kelvin Moore is probably the most horribly underrated fullback of all time, suffered as he played in an era of great fullbacks, Dench and Southby, remember when backs weren't allowed to grapple. Loved Moore when he would run straight line on his way, did it so many times.
As a hawks supporter he lost nothing on the others in comparison.
